  • Q: How do I use the B+W Vario ND filter? A: To use the B+W Vario ND filter, simply screw it onto the front of your lens. Adjust the density by rotating the filter, allowing you to set the density between one and five stops.

  • Q: Can I stack this filter with other lenses? A: Yes, you can stack this filter with additional B+W ND filters for higher density options. However, ensure that the Vario ND is used as the outermost filter.
  • Q: What type of photography is this filter best for? A: This filter is best for landscape and portrait photography. It helps in managing exposure during bright conditions, allowing for creative effects.

  • Q: Is this filter compatible with full-frame cameras? A: Yes, the B+W Vario ND filter is compatible with full-frame cameras. Its extra-wide design helps avoid vignetting even at wide angles.
  • Q: How does the Multi-Resistant Coating benefit the filter? A: The Multi-Resistant Coating on the filter reduces reflections and enhances light transmission. This ensures clearer images and improved contrast in photographs.
